Introduction to the process of low temperature concentration + evaporation and crystallisation of centrifuged salt:

The previous section describes how the brine is concentrated by low temperature evaporation to near saturation concentration (25-29%) and discharged to the next process. This article continues with the subsequent treatment process of the crystallised effluent salt. The highly concentrated brine enters a forced circulation evaporator after heat exchange and is heated with raw steam for evaporation, with the resulting secondary steam used as the heat source for low temperature evaporation. As evaporation proceeds, the concentration of salt in the waste water becomes higher and higher, and when it exceeds saturation, the salt precipitates out continuously, and after treatment, the solid sodium chloride is packaged and sold.
In the salt crystallisation plant, our team uses a number of innovative technologies, such as the use of self-cleaning devices to effectively remove scaling and the adhesion of organic matter and salt to the inner walls of the plant, the installation of a rotating foam trap in the upper part of the evaporation chamber to reduce the phenomenon of salt carried by droplets, and the installation of a deflector plate in the salt sludge tank to promote the growth of crystal salt and improve product quality, which has resulted in improved product quality and continuous operation of the plant These innovations have improved the quality of the product and the continuous operation of the plant, reduced the labour intensity of the workers and lowered the overall operating costs.
The low temperature concentration + evaporation and crystallisation process is very suitable for plants without low grade heat source, firstly, the low concentration salt-containing wastewater is concentrated to a higher concentration, then it enters the evaporation and crystallisation system to evaporate and crystallise, using the secondary steam generated by the evaporation and crystallisation device as the heat source for low temperature concentration, making full use of the heat energy of each link and minimising energy consumption. Evaporation of one ton of fresh water consumes only 200kg of raw steam and 15 degrees of electricity, far lower than the consumption of traditional evaporation and crystallisation.
